Yuliya Zaripova takes 3,000m steeplechase gold

Yuliya Zaripova wins gold for Russia in the final of the women's 3000m steeplechase.

Russia's Yuliya Zaripova claimed the Olympic gold medal from this evening's women's 3,000m steeplechase.

The 26-year-old was always in contention as she settled herself towards the front of the field during the opening exchanges of the race.

Then, having heard the bell, Zaripova made a move for the front and continued to move away from her rivals on her way to winning in 9:06.72, which was the third-quickest time ever over that distance.

Silver went to Tunisia's Habiba Ghribi, who set a national record time of 9:08.37.

Ethiopia's Sofia Assefa took the bronze medal.
